About Peter Schueler

Peter Schueler is a scholar working on Cognitive Neuroscience, Pharmacology, Neurology, Computer Vision and Pattern Recognition and Neurology, having authored 3 papers that have together received 91 indexed citations. Recurring topics across this work include Parkinson's Disease Mechanisms and Treatments (1 paper), EEG and Brain-Computer Interfaces (1 paper), Treatment of Major Depression (1 paper), Context-Aware Activity Recognition Systems (1 paper), Gaze Tracking and Assistive Technology (1 paper), Meta-analysis and systematic reviews (1 paper), Botulinum Toxin and Related Neurological Disorders (1 paper) and Pain Management and Placebo Effect (1 paper). The work is most often cited by research in Neurology (24 citations), Cognitive Neuroscience (30 citations), Health Informatics (2 citations), Experimental and Cognitive Psychology (10 citations) and Cellular and Molecular Neuroscience (11 citations). Peter Schueler has collaborated with scholars based in Germany, Netherlands and United States. Frequent co-authors include Marie Mc Carthy, Bill Byrom, Willie Muehlhausen, H. Baas, Dong‐Jing Fu, Larry Alphs, William P. Horan, D. Demolle, Ariana Anderson and Joseph Geraci. Their work appears in journals such as Clinical Pharmacology & Therapeutics, European Neurology and PubMed.
